$mime->header_set('References', '<zz-mid@b>');
ok($im->add($mime), 'message with multiple Message-ID');
$im->done;
- my ($total, undef) = $ibx->over->recent;
+ my $total = $ibx->over->dbh->selectrow_array(<<'');
+SELECT COUNT(*) FROM over WHERE num > 0
+
is($ibx->mm->num_highwater, $total, 'got expected highwater value');
my $srch = $ibx->search;
my $mset1 = $srch->reopen->query('m:abcde@1', { mset => 1 });
like($tip, qr/\A[a-f0-9]+ test removal\n\z/s,
'commit message propagated to git');
is_deeply(\@after, \@before, 'only one commit written to git');
- is($ibx->mm->num_for($smsg->mid), undef, 'no longer in Msgmap by mid');
+ my $mid = $smsg->{mid};
+ is($ibx->mm->num_for($mid), undef, 'no longer in Msgmap by mid');
my $num = $smsg->{num};
like($num, qr/\A\d+\z/, 'numeric number in return message');
is($ibx->mm->mid_for($num), undef, 'no longer in Msgmap by num');
my $srch = $ibx->search->reopen;
- my $mset = $srch->query('m:'.$smsg->mid, { mset => 1});
+ my $mset = $srch->query('m:'.$mid, { mset => 1});
is($mset->size, 0, 'no longer found in Xapian');
my @log1 = (@log, qw(-1 --pretty=raw --raw -r --no-renames));
is($srch->{over_ro}->get_art($num), undef,